Error presenter definovany v config.neon se nenacte
Upozornění: Tohle vlákno je hodně staré a informace nemusí být platné pro současné Nette.
- ZZromanZZ
- Člen | 87
ErrorPresenter definovany v config.neon takto:
nette:
application:
errorPresenter: Error
se vubec nenacte( nacte se default sablona)
Ale definovany v bootstrapu jako:
$container->application->errorPresenter = 'Error';
se nacte v poradku.
V obou pripadech vypise dump($container->application) errorPresenter ⇒ „Error“
Delam nekde neco spatne?
… pouzivam nette verze 2.0 stable
- toka
- Člen | 253
bootstrap.php
// Enable Nette Debugger for error visualisation & logging
$configurator->setDebugMode($configurator::PRODUCTION); // Comment for Error Presenter
$configurator->enableDebugger(__DIR__ . '/../log');
config.neon
common:
nette:
application:
#debugger: false # Toto musí být zakomentované, nebo se nesmí vůbec vyskytovat - ani true, ani false
#catchExceptions: false # Toto musí být zakomentované, nebo se nesmí vůbec vyskytovat - ani true, ani false
errorPresenter: Error
A pak už stačí mít Error presenter a templates na správných místech – např. app/presenters a app/templates.